Alarm bells ring at Tigerland
richmondfc.com.au
Tue 04 Jan, 2011
The first day back at Tigerland for 2011 got off to an alarming start for Richmond coach Damien Hardwick.
Returning from the Christmas break this morning, Hardwick reported for duty in his old office underneath the Jack Dyer Stand, but instantly, his eager mind began to wander.
With the finishing touches being put on the ME Bank Centre, the new home for the coaches and players, Hardwick decided to poke his head in to check on the progress of the new facility.
He lasted only a few seconds in his new surroundings before the alarm was tripped, and he was forced to evacuate.
The police arrived swiftly on the scene to investigate, but were pleased to find a red-faced Hardwick fess up to his misdemeanour.
